Health care law will raise insurers' costs, actuaries say

27 Mar Posted by: LHoang Category: Health

Washington (CNN) – Republican opponents of President Obama's Affordable Care Act got some new ammunition this week: A study released by the Society of Actuaries on Tuesday predicts that costs could rise an average of 32% by 2017 for insurers serving the individual health care market.

Health overhaul to raise claims cost 32%, study says

26 Mar Posted by: LHoang Category: Health

WASHINGTON   -- Medical claims costs -- the biggest driver of health insurance premiums -- will jump an average 32 percent for Americans' individual policies under President Barack Obama's overhaul, according to a study by the nation's leading group of financial risk analysts.
